Randy's Social Background and Peer Group

Randy Anderson belongs to the Socs, a group of wealthy teenagers from the west side of town. His social status shapes much of his behavior and internal conflict in the novel.

Being a Soc means he grew up with privilege, yet he feels trapped by expectations from his friends and family. This background explains why his interactions with the Greasers carry tension and curiosity.

Randy's Character Traits and Development

Unlike many Socs who enjoy tormenting Greasers, Randy shows sensitivity and doubt. He questions the value of fights and the endless rivalry between the groups.

His conversations with Ponyboy reveal a longing for meaning beyond social labels. This complexity makes him more than a simple antagonist or foil.

Key Relationships and Conflicts

Randy's relationship with Bob Sheldon influences his actions, even after Bob's death. He grapples with loyalty to his friend and the consequences of group violence.

His dynamic with Ponyboy and the Greasers highlights themes of empathy and understanding across social divides. Moments of honesty challenge both sides to see beyond stereotypes.

Thematic Role of Randy in the Story

Randy represents the possibility of change within rigid social divisions. His struggle reflects the broader conflict between class and identity.

Through his character, the story questions whether individuals can break free from groupthink and take responsibility for their choices.

What is Randy's last name in The Outsiders?

Randy's last name is Anderson, making his full name Randy Anderson.

Which social group does Randy belong to in the novel?

Randy is part of the Socs, the affluent group of teenagers who clash with the Greasers.

How does Randy's personality differ from other Socs?

He is more thoughtful and conflicted, often questioning the violence and status-driven behavior common among his peers. Randy expresses regret about the fighting and admits he would have withdrawn from the rivalry if he could, showing his desire for peace.
